As it was a nice sunny day today, and i'd already taken the dog for it's walk, tidy'd the garden up & there was still an hour to the football on the telly, i thought i'd have a bash at fitting the rear light guards i recently purchased. Here is how i did it.............
First, i put some masking tape down the side of the light
Then temp fitted the guard & rubber mounts, then outlined the rubber mount with a pen.
Then, holding the rubber mount, marken the fixing holes with a small allen key.
Next, drill 2 x 5mm holes.
After drilling the holes, i sprayed a bit of paint to the bare metal, then before fitting the rubber mounts,
I put a bit of copper slip on the rear, like so..
Then this is where it gets a bit fiddely, trying to get the washer & nut on the back, as you can see,
it's a bit tight, especially when you've got fat, short fingers like me !!
With all the rubber mounts fitted.....
It was time to fit the guard, job done !!
